What is Mendelian Genetics?

Back

Mendelian Genetics is the study of how traits are inherited through the interactions of alleles, based on the principles established by Gregor Mendel.

What does it mean for a trait to be dominant?

Back

A dominant trait is one that is expressed in the phenotype even when only one copy of the allele is present.

What does it mean for a trait to be recessive?

Back

A recessive trait is one that is only expressed in the phenotype when two copies of the allele are present.

What is a Punnett Square?

Back

A Punnett Square is a diagram used to predict the genetic makeup of offspring from a cross between two parents.

What is Mendel's Law of Segregation?

Back

Mendel's Law of Segregation states that during the formation of gametes, the two alleles for a trait separate from each other.

How many alleles do you inherit from each parent for a specific trait?

Back

You inherit one allele from each parent for a specific trait, making a total of two alleles.

What is a genotype?

Back

A genotype is the genetic makeup of an organism, represented by the alleles it possesses.
